Quote of the day by Charlie Chaplin: “Life is a tragedy when seen in close-up, but a comedy in long-shot.”

This is one of Charlie Chaplin’s most famous and well-documented lines, taken from his interviews and writings about cinema and life.

It perfectly blends his humour with his philosophy, the same mix that made him one of the greatest artists of the 20th century.


Who Was Charlie Chaplin and Why Are His Words Still Quoted?

Charlie Chaplin was more than a silent-film actor. He was a writer, director, composer and political thinker who used comedy to talk about poverty, injustice, loneliness and power.

Born in London, Chaplin lived through hardship, world wars and exile. His quotes are valued because they come from someone who saw life from both the bottom and the top of society.

What Does This Charlie Chaplin Quote Mean?

When Chaplin said “Life is a tragedy when seen in close-up, but a comedy in long-shot,” he was borrowing the language of filmmaking.

A close-up shows pain in detail.

A long-shot shows the wider picture.

He was saying that when we focus only on our own problems, life feels tragic. But when we step back and see the bigger story of humanity, struggles become part of a strange, often funny journey.

How This Quote Reflects Chaplin’s Films

Chaplin’s films work exactly like this quote.

The Tramp is often poor, lonely and humiliated, tragic in close-up. But when you watch the whole story, his struggles turn into comedy, hope and resilience.

This quote explains the emotional magic behind City Lights, The Kid and Modern Times.

Why Charlie Chaplin’s Quote Still Feels True Today

In an age of stress, social media and constant pressure, Chaplin’s words are more relevant than ever.

They remind us to zoom out, laugh at ourselves, and remember that even hard moments are part of a larger human story.
